# Break-Glass: Catalog Cache Invalidation

Scope: the Pinrow product catalog at Veldstone Retail. If stale prices persist after a purge and the Hollowmere invalidation queue is wedged, use break-glass to flush the edge tier directly. Contractors: get verbal sign-off from the catalog lead first. Steps: open the Hollowmere admin shell, select emergency-flush, confirm the tenant, and run it once — repeated flushes thrash the origin. Access is logged and expires after 20 minutes. Unseal the admin shell with the passphrase below.

recovery phrase for kahop-tajog: istix-casvan

Test plan note, Finchline uploads: verify the encoding sniffer handles UTF-8 with BOM, UTF-16LE, and legacy Windows-1252 files without mangling umlauts. Also toss in a deliberately mixed-encoding file and confirm we reject it cleanly rather than guessing. Running the suite against staging needs auth — grab the token below.

session JWT of tadup-kaguf = eyJhbGciOiJIUzI1NiIsInR5cCI6IkpXVCJ9.eyJzdWIiOiItNz4V3In0.KrZCeqpk

## Changelog — Ticktrace 1.9

### Renamed: DRIFT_API_TOKEN
During the cron drift investigation we found plugins confusing this variable with the metrics token, so it has been renamed to indicate it authorizes drift-report uploads specifically. Plugin authors must read the new name from 1.9 onward; the old name is ignored without warning. Sample env files in the SDK are updated. In your deployment env file, the drift-report upload secret is set on the next line.

env line for fawef-taguf: VAULT_KEY13=a9695905a9a90

**CI note: image slimming for the Ferrowatch builder**

After switching to the distroless base, the Ferrowatch pipeline shrank images from 1.4 GB to 310 MB, but shell-based health checks broke silently. Replace any `sh -c` probes with the static `probectl` binary before merging. Verify layer counts stay under 40, since the registry mirror in our Delmont cluster rejects larger manifests. Confirm against the trace token recorded below.

pipeline stamp: htk3_cc5